Description
The JRC would like to procure a new gas detection system, consisting of oxygen and hydrogen detectors (approx. 12 oxygen detectors and approx. 4 hydrogen detectors, exact numbers depending on the technology used), and a central control unit, for its High-Pressure Gas Testing Facility (GASTEF) to replace an outdated one. The GASTEF facility is used for the experimental assessment of safety and performance of systems and components under pressurised hydrogen, and the gas detection system has a safety purpose for the facility. Some of the detectors will need to be able to operate in an inert atmosphere, i.e. nitrogen, and be compliant to ATEX zone 2 (Hydrogen) requirements. The procurement will need to include the supply of the gas detection system equipment, its installation and commissioning at the GASTEF facility, and preventive and corrective maintenances for a period of 8 years.
